Before You Begin: Safety First
Before touching any wires or switches, remember that your Carrier air conditioner involves high-voltage electricity. Always prioritize safety. Make sure you’re wearing rubber-soled shoes, avoid working during rain or wet conditions, and never attempt repairs if you’re unsure about electrical components. If your unit has exposed wiring or shows signs of damage (like burn marks or melted parts), stop immediately and contact a licensed HVAC technician.
Also, consult your owner’s manual for model-specific guidance. While most Carrier units follow similar reset procedures, newer models with inverter technology or smart features may require different steps. Having your model number handy (usually found on a data plate on the outdoor unit) helps ensure you’re following the correct process.
Step 1: Turn Off the Thermostat
Set Your Thermostat to Off
Start by switching your thermostat from “Cool” to “Off.” This stops the compressor from receiving commands and prevents further energy use while you work on the unit. For digital thermostats, press the “System Off” button or slide the mode dial to “Off.”

Unplug Smart Thermostats (If Applicable)
If you have a Nest, Ecobee, or other Wi-Fi-enabled thermostat, unplug it from the wall for 30 seconds. This ensures a full memory flush and resets network connections that might be interfering with your Carrier unit’s operation.
Step 2: Locate the Main Electrical Disconnect
Your Carrier air conditioner’s power supply typically runs through a dedicated circuit breaker in your home’s electrical panel. Look for a breaker labeled “HVAC,” “AC,” or with a capacity matching your unit’s BTU rating (e.g., 20 amp).
In some cases, especially with older models, there may also be a disconnect switch mounted directly on or near the outdoor condenser unit. It’s a small black box with a red lever—turn it to the “Off” position.
Tip:
If you can’t find the breaker, check the label on your furnace (if you have a gas model) or look for a large wire bundle entering the side of the house. Trace those wires back to the breaker panel.
Step 3: Power Down the System
Flip the Breaker to Off
Once located, turn the breaker completely off. You should hear a click and see the indicator move to the neutral position. Leave it off for at least five full minutes. This waiting period allows internal capacitors to discharge and resets the control board’s memory.
Optional: Remove Fuse (For Older Models)
Some pre-2000 Carrier units use fuses instead of breakers. If yours does, locate the fuse box inside your indoor air handler (usually in the attic or basement). Remove the fuse, wait two minutes, then reinstall it.
Step 4: Wait and Reboot
After five minutes, flip the breaker back to “On.” You’ll hear the condenser fan kick in momentarily, signaling power restoration. Give the system another minute to stabilize.
Reconnect Smart Thermostats
Plug your smart thermostat back in and allow it 60 seconds to reconnect to Wi-Fi and sync with the HVAC system. Then set the thermostat to your desired temperature.
Step 5: Test the System
Monitor for Normal Operation
Listen for the compressor engaging—this should happen within 1–3 minutes of setting the thermostat. Check vents for cold air output. If the unit starts but still feels weak, wait 30 more minutes; sometimes it takes time to reach full capacity.
Watch for Error Codes
Modern Carrier thermostats display diagnostic messages like “E1” (sensor issue) or “F1” (freeze condition). Write down any codes you see—they help technicians diagnose problems later.

Troubleshooting Common Post-Reset Issues
Even after a successful reset, some symptoms may persist. Here’s how to address them:
Unit Won’t Start After Reset
This usually indicates a deeper electrical fault. Check for loose connections at the breaker, inspect fuses for melting, and verify no circuit overloads exist (e.g., too many appliances running simultaneously).
Short Cycling (Turning On/Off Rapidly)
This overheating risk suggests either a dirty air filter restricting airflow or a failing compressor relay. Replace the filter first—it’s free and takes less than five minutes.
Strange Noises During Operation
Rattling often means loose panels; buzzing may signal voltage imbalance. Never ignore loud sounds—schedule maintenance promptly.
Ice Buildup on Evaporator Coil
Usually caused by low refrigerant or blocked return ducts. A reset alone won’t fix this—you’ll need professional service to recharge freon levels.
Preventative Maintenance to Avoid Future Resets
Regular upkeep reduces the chance your Carrier unit needs frequent rebooting:
- Replace pleated filters every 90 days
- Clean condenser coils annually with a coil brush and degreaser
- Trim shrubbery away from outdoor unit (leave 2 feet clearance)
- Schedule biannual professional tune-ups (spring and fall)
These small efforts extend equipment life by 10–15 years and maintain SEER efficiency ratings.
When to Call a Professional
Contact an HVAC technician if:
- The reset resolves nothing after two attempts
- You smell burning or ozone near the unit
- Refrigerant lines are visibly rusted or leaking
- Your electricity bill spikes abnormally high
